Understanding the Small Engine Carburetor
The small engine carburetor is a complex yet ingenious device, consisting of several parts that work together to achieve its purpose. It's essentially a venturi, a tube with a constricted section that causes an increase in the speed of fluid flow, creating a low-pressure zone.

This low-pressure zone is where the fuel is drawn into the airstream, creating the perfect fuel-air mixture. The carburetor also regulates the amount of fuel based on the engine's demand, ensuring optimal performance and fuel efficiency.
Key Components of a Small Engine Carburetor

To understand how a small engine carburetor works, it's essential to know its key components. These include the float chamber, the main jet, the idle jet, and the needle valve. The float chamber stores the fuel, while the main and idle jets control the fuel flow. The needle valve regulates the fuel-air mixture, ensuring the engine runs smoothly at different speeds.
Regular maintenance and cleaning of these components are crucial to keep the carburetor in top condition. Clogged jets and valves can lead to poor engine performance, reduced fuel efficiency, and even engine failure.
Types of Small Engine Carburetors

Small engine carburetors come in various types, each designed to cater to specific engine needs. The most common types are the float-type carburetor and the diaphragm-type carburetor. The float-type carburetor uses a float to control the fuel level in the float chamber, while the diaphragm-type uses a diaphragm to control fuel flow.
Other types include the constant velocity (CV) carburetor, which maintains a constant fuel-air mixture regardless of engine speed, and the pressure carburetor, which uses a pump to force fuel into the engine.

Signs of a Failing Carburetor
Despite their robustness, small engine carburetors can fail over time due to wear and tear, or as a result of poor maintenance. Some common signs of a failing carburetor include difficulty starting the engine, poor engine performance, increased fuel consumption, and excessive emissions.
If you notice any of these signs, it's crucial to address the issue promptly. A malfunctioning carburetor can lead to more significant problems, including engine damage and increased repair costs.
Carburetor Maintenance Tips
Regular maintenance is key to keeping your small engine carburetor in top condition. This includes regular cleaning to remove dirt and debris, checking and adjusting the fuel-air mixture, and replacing worn-out parts.
It's also a good idea to use high-quality fuel and fuel additives designed for small engines. These can help prevent fuel-related issues and keep your carburetor in good working order.
